Types of HIV Home Test Kits

If you have been considering to opt for HIV home test, then there are two methods as approved by the Food and DrugAdministration (FDA). The two methods of HIV Home Test Kits include the following- Home Access HIV-1 Test System and the Ora-quick HIV Test Kit.

Home Access HIV-1 Test System

This home testing kit has received approval from FDA ever since July, 1996. All you will need to do is take a sample of your blood and send it off to the lab for processing. However, if you want to use this kit, you will first need to register for it. You can call to the toll-free number and get access to the kit. However, specific processes are carried out before determining the whole procedure. The step includes to undergo an anonymous interview and pre-counseling. Then, you can proceed to collecting blood and send it to the lab for examining.

It usually takes a day or two to receive the proper results. Nonetheless, you will be required to call the toll-free number to know about your results. Usually, you results are double-checked before handing it over to you. So, if you have received a negative result, you don’t need to double check it.

For the screening of Hepatitis B, blood tests are carried out. The wide range of blood tests include



Hepatitis B surface antigen test
The presence of Hepatitis B surface antigen would indicate that you're are affected. The positive results mean that you are capable of spreading it however the absence means you will not. Nonetheless, the test won't indicate any difference between serious and mild disease.

Hepatitis B core antigen test
The presence of the core antigen would determine if you had been affected currently or not. The positive results means it may either be serious or mild. However, it can determine that you are recovering from the disease.

Hepatitis B antibody test
This test determines the immunity of HBV. The possible result shows that you are safe against the disease.

Liver function test
This is very essential for Hepatitis B patients. The presence of excess enzyme means you are affected. It also helps you determine which part is not functioning properly.

What is a HIV test?

One of the most common ways that can help to determine HIV in any human is blood test. The HIV test helps to find the following

Antibodies- These are produced by body when the body tries to fight against HIV.
Antigens- The protein contains of the HIV cell.
Antigens as well as antibodies

Mostly after the outbreak of the infection, antigens are found in huge quantity in the bloodstream. Nonetheless, these usually disappear after a few days. However, antibodies usually take time to appear in the blood stream. It can take about 6 to 12 weeks. After the outbreak of these antibodies, these can be found in the bloodstream.

Once you go to get the test, the negative result indicates that there is no growing sign of any infection. A positive result would determine that you are affected by the infection. Chlamydia


This is the STD caused by bacteria which is basically transmitted due to anal, oral and vaginal sex with the infected person. This is one of the most common forms of sexually transmitted diseases around the world. Usually it happens that people suffering from chlamydia do not notice significant symptoms. Nevertheless, the people who show symptoms of being infected do it within a week.

Some of the symptoms of chlamydia includes

  • Pain while urination
  • Penile discharge (men)
  • Pain while sexual intercourse
  • Swollen testicles (in men)

Some of the other symptoms which are very common while suffering from chlamydia include

  • Discharge
  • Bleeding
  • Pain in the rectal area
